Adding or Erasing Channels You can add or erase channels from the list in the TV's memory. Press MENU to see the main menu. Press CH+ or CH- to highlight Setup. Press OK to enter the Setup submenu. TV/CATV is highlighted. Press VOL+ or VOL- to select TV or CATV (whichever you have). Details are on page 11. Press CH+ or CH- repeatedly to highlight Channel. Press VOL+ or VOL- to enter the channel number you want to add or erase. Press CH+ or CH- repeatedly to highlight Add/Erase. Press VOL+ or VOL- to choose Add or Erase. If you select Add, the channel will be available when you press CH+ and CHto move through channels. Choosing Erase will remove the channel from the TV's memory. The channel will not be available when you flip through channels with the CH+ and CH- buttons. Press MENU repeatedly to exit the menu or the menu will automatically disappear within a few seconds if no buttons are pressed on the remote control. You won't see the change take effect until you scroll through the channels in memory using the CH+/- buttons. Main Menu Picture Sound Preferences Time Setup Models 20V412T and 20V500T: If you have one of these models you won't see the Sound menu and your remote will not have the MTS or SOUND buttons. Helpful Hints You cannot select the Setup menu if the TV is set to a video input channel (FRNT).
